public CxDataProvider(PluginParams param, IBillings billings, IUsers users) { _billings = billings; PluginParams = param; _clientManager = ClientManager.ClientManager.GetManager(); _clients = _clientManager.GetClients(); _users = users; }
private void LoadParams() { GlobalLogManager.WriteString("WCFManager. Загрузка параметров"); lock (_paramLock) { _param = PluginParams.LoadParams(GlobalUtils.AppDirectory); } GlobalLogManager.WriteString("WCFManager. Загрузка параметров выполнена"); }
public static void CreateFile(string path) { using (Stream writer = new FileStream(path + "\\" + FileName, FileMode.Create)) { var param = new PluginParams(); XmlSerializer serializer = new XmlSerializer(typeof(PluginParams)); serializer.Serialize(writer, param); } }